Kerry Robert Associates are delighted to be recruiting for an experienced Hotel Finance Manager in the Durham area. This is an excellent opportunity for a hospitality finance professional looking to take the next step in their career with a respected hotel company. As Hotel Finance Manager, you will play a key role in overseeing the hotel's financial operations, ensuring accurate reporting, strong financial controls, and effective business support to the management team.

The successful candidate must have a strong background in hotel finance and be confident in managing month-end processes, preparing journals, and analysing financial performance through monthly profit and loss and balance sheet reviews.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Prepare and post month-end journals and accruals
  • Produce and review monthly management accounts, including P&L and balance sheet analysis
  • Maintain robust financial controls and reporting procedures
  • Support budgeting, forecasting, and financial planning processes
  • Work closely with operational departments to drive financial performance
  • Ensure compliance with company policies and accounting standards
  • Utilise hotel finance systems and technology to improve efficiency and reporting

The successful candidate must have:

  • Previous experience as a Finance Supervisor, Assistant Financial Controller, Finance Manager, or Financial Controller
  • A minimum of two years' experience within a hotel finance department (essential)
  • Strong knowledge of hotel accounting and finance operations
  • Experience working within a self-accounting hotel environment
  • Excellent analytical and organisational skills
  • IT savvy with experience using hotel PMS, EPOS and finance systems
  • Capable of working independently while building effective relationships across all different departments

Benefits:

  • Location: Durham area (on-site role / NO hybrid)
  • Salary range: £40,000 to £45,000 plus great company benefits
